What vps_get_action does on Hostinger
AI agents call vps_get_action to retrieve information from Hostinger without modifying anything. It is typically the context-gathering step in research, monitoring, and reporting workflows, before the agent takes action elsewhere.
Why vps_get_action is rated Low
The verb 'get' combined with 'details' clearly denotes a read-only operation that retrieves information about an existing VPS action. No data is created, modified, deleted, or executed. This poses minimal security risk as it only exposes existing information.
From the tool's definition Tool name 'vps_get_action' and description 'Get details of a specific VPS action' indicate a retrieval/query operation with no side effects.

Questions about vps_get_action
Get details of a specific VPS action. It is categorised as a Read tool in the Hostinger MCP Server, which means it retrieves data without modifying state.
Register the Hostinger MCP server in PolicyLayer and add a rule for vps_get_action: allow, deny, rate-limit, or require approval. Point your MCP client at the PolicyLayer proxy URL and the rule is enforced on every call, before it reaches Hostinger. Nothing to install.
vps_get_action is a Read tool with low risk. Read-only tools are generally safe to allow by default.
Yes. Add a rate_limit block to the vps_get_action rule in your PolicyLayer policy. For example, setting max: 10 and window: 60 limits the tool to 10 calls per minute. Rate limits are tracked per agent session and reset automatically.
Set action: deny in the PolicyLayer policy for vps_get_action. The AI agent will receive a policy violation error and cannot call the tool. You can also include a reason field to explain why the tool is blocked.
vps_get_action is provided by the Hostinger MCP server (idugeni/hostinger-mcp). PolicyLayer sits as a proxy in front of this server to enforce policies before tool calls reach the server.
